Videos tagged with Source
Open Source is MagicChris DiBona (Google)Google Open Source Programs Manager Chris DiBona will discuss how, in fact, Open Source is too good to be true and thus must be magic. He will talk about how open source came into being, what it is, what it is not, and how Google uses it to write its software, release software to you and maybe make life a little more magical for you, too.
Google I/O 2008 - Open Source Projects and Poisonous People
How Open Source Projects Survive Poisonous PeopleBrian Fitzpatrick and Ben Collins-Sussman (Google)Every project runs into people who are selfish, uncooperative, and disrespectful. These people can silently poison the atmosphere of a happy developer community. Come learn how to identify these people and peacefully de-fuse them before they derail your project. Told through a series of (often amu...
Google I/O 2008 - Open Source is Magic
Open Source is MagicChris DiBona (Google)Google Open Source Programs Manager Chris DiBona will discuss how, in fact, Open Source is too good to be true and thus must be magic. He will talk about how open source came into being, what it is, what it is not, and how Google uses it to write its software, release software to you and maybe make life a little more magical for you, too.
Google I/O 2008 - Open Source Projects and Poisonous People
How Open Source Projects Survive Poisonous PeopleBrian Fitzpatrick and Ben Collins-Sussman (Google)Every project runs into people who are selfish, uncooperative, and disrespectful. These people can silently poison the atmosphere of a happy developer community. Come learn how to identify these people and peacefully de-fuse them before they derail your project. Told through a series of (often amu...
Lecture 27 | Programming Paradigms (Stanford)
Lecture by Sasha Rush for the Programming Paradigms (CS107) course in the Stanford University Computer Science department. Sasha lectures on the Haskell programming language, providing several code examples while comparing it to other common programming languages.Programming Paradigms (CS107) introduces several programming languages, including C, Assembly, C++, Concurrent Programming, Scheme, a...
Lecture 26 | Programming Paradigms (Stanford)
Lecture by Professor Jerry Cain for Programming Paradigms (CS107) in the Stanford University Computer Science department. In this lecture, Prof. Cain lectures on the Python programming language in relation to XML processing and the internet.Programming Paradigms (CS107) introduces several programming languages, including C, Assembly, C++, Concurrent Programming, Scheme, and Python. The class ai...
Lecture 25 | Programming Paradigms (Stanford)
Lecture by Professor Jerry Cain for Programming Paradigms (CS107) in the Stanford University Computer Science department. In this lecture, Prof. Cain discusses the Python dictionary and illustrates a small program containing the imperative, object-oriented, and functional paradigms.Programming Paradigms (CS107) introduces several programming languages, including C, Assembly, C++, Concurrent Pro...
Lecture 24 | Programming Paradigms (Stanford)
Lecture by Professor Jerry Cain for Programming Paradigms (CS107) in the Stanford University Computer Science department. In this lecture, Prof. Cain introduces Python, a scripting language, by providing a basic overview of the language and some examples.Programming Paradigms (CS107) introduces several programming languages, including C, Assembly, C++, Concurrent Programming, Scheme, and Python...
Lecture 23 | Programming Paradigms (Stanford)
Lecture by Professor Jerry Cain for Programming Paradigms (CS107) in the Stanford University Computer Science department. In this lecture, Prof. Cain discusses memory models in Scheme programming language by giving several detailed examples.Programming Paradigms (CS107) introduces several programming languages, including C, Assembly, C++, Concurrent Programming, Scheme, and Python. The class ai...
Lecture 22 | Programming Paradigms (Stanford)
Lecture by Professor Jerry Cain for Programming Paradigms (CS107) in the Stanford University Computer Science department. In this lecture, Prof. Cain elaborates upon Scheme programming language by giving several detailed code examples.Programming Paradigms (CS107) introduces several programming languages, including C, Assembly, C++, Concurrent Programming, Scheme, and Python. The class aims to ...